如何使用MATLAB-Simulink设计一个DSB调制解调器,并分析其频谱特性?请提供详细步骤。
时间: 2024-11-02 19:18:23 浏览: 22
在通信系统的设计和分析中,DSB调制解调器的建模与性能评估是核心步骤之一。为了深入理解DSB调制解调器的工作原理及其频谱特性,建议参考《MATLAB-Simulink实现DSB系统调制解调仿真及其分析》这份资料。通过这份课程设计,你将能够通过实践操作来掌握DSB系统的调制与解调过程。
参考资源链接:[MATLAB-Simulink实现DSB系统调制解调仿真及其分析](https://wenku.csdn.net/doc/13npdjaiqn?spm=1055.2569.3001.10343)
首先,你需要理解DSB调制的基本概念。DSB调制是通过将基带信号与高频载波相乘来实现的,这样可以将基带信号的频谱搬移到载波频率附近。解调过程则相反,它通过与载波频率的本地振荡信号相乘并使用低通滤波器来恢复原始信号。
在MATLAB-Simulink环境下,你可以利用其丰富的工具箱来构建DSB调制解调系统模型。以下是一个基础步骤指导:
1. 打开MATLAB软件,启动Simulink,并创建一个新模型。
2. 在Simulink库浏览器中找到所需的模块,如“Sine Wave”模块用于生成载波信号,“Math Operations”模块用于实现乘法运算,以及“Spectrum Analyzer”模块用于分析频谱特性。
3. 构建DSB调制器:将基带信号和载波信号输入到一个乘法器中,然后将乘法器的输出连接到一个带通滤波器以过滤出DSB信号。
4. 构建DSB解调器:使用一个本地振荡器产生一个与载波相同频率的信号,同样经过乘法器和低通滤波器,以恢复原始基带信号。
5. 将“Spectrum Analyzer”模块连接到调制器和解调器的输出端,以观察和分析信号的频谱特性。
完成模型构建后,运行仿真并调整参数,观察调制与解调过程对信号频谱特性的影响。你可以通过改变载波频率、信号幅度或噪声水平等参数,来分析它们对系统性能的具体影响。
通过这一过程,你不仅可以直观地理解DSB信号的频谱搬移原理,还可以学习如何使用MATLAB-Simulink进行通信系统的设计与分析。《MATLAB-Simulink实现DSB系统调制解调仿真及其分析》将为你提供理论知识与实践操作相结合的详细教程,帮助你更好地掌握DSB通信系统的设计和性能优化方法。
参考资源链接:[MATLAB-Simulink实现DSB系统调制解调仿真及其分析](https://wenku.csdn.net/doc/13npdjaiqn?spm=1055.2569.3001.10343)
阅读全文